two.2.4) Description of the procurement

Homes England is exploring how we could improve access for customers to Affordable Home Ownership schemes such as Shared Ownership and Rent to Buy.

Currently customers can search and register for grant funded Shared Ownership homes with one of our Help to Buy Agents. Over 100,000 customers register for these services each year. The current service is expected to end in March 2023 and this engagement exercise is to help us understand what the market could potentially deliver from April 2023.

Whilst the current service was procured to support the delivery of Shared Ownership homes which have been funded using Homes England grant, we are exploring the possibility of extending this to include other Affordable Home Ownership schemes including those not funded by Homes England. This could be in the region of approximately 20,000 homes per year listed on these sites. These homes could have varying eligibility criteria and scheme rules so helping customers navigate their options would be a key priority for us.
